I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Réseau Discussion :

configuration bind apache


Sujet :

Réseau

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re du Club
    Homme Profil pro
    Inscrit en
    Janvier 2013
    Messages
    10
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ations forums :
    Inscription : Janvier 2013
    Messages : 10
    Par défaut configuration bind apache
    bonjour à tous.

    J'ai actuellement un serveur dédié chez ovh et tout fonctionne las bas ^^ ( apache, redirection de domaine .. )

    j'ai monter chez moi , un pc avec une distrib débian 6 afin de faire mes test sans risque.
    l'ip de ce pc est 192.168.1.142.

    j'ai fais toutes la configuration apache, mysql .. tout fonctionne.
    j'ai même mis en place un serveur samba, et j'ai créer et activer un fichier site dans /etc/apache2/sites-available .. tout fonctionne quand je tape le nom du pc dans l'explorateur.

    Le problème c'est bind :

    j’ai suivi scrupuleusement les tutoriels pour avoir un nom de domaine “ factice” sur mon réseau local personnel ( intranet )

    malheureusement, rien n’y fait : malgré les test avec la commande nslookup qui aboutissent bien , mon domaine ne marche pas ( je le tape dans l’explorateur mais j’arrive sur une page : Adresse introuvable ....

    j’ espère ne pas vous embêter, mais j’ai fais un récapitulatif de ma configuration :


    contenu de /etc/resolv.conf

    nameserver 192.168.1.142
    domain bureau.local

    contenu de /etc/bind/named.conf.local

    //
    // Do any local configuration here
    //

    // Consider adding the 1918 zones here, if they are not used in your
    // organization
    //include "/etc/bind/zones.rfc1918";

    zone "bureau.local" {
    type master;
    file "/etc/bind/db.bureau.local";
    };
    zone "1.168.192.in-addr.arpa" {
    type master;
    file "/etc/bind/db.1.168.192";
    };


    contenu de /etc/bind/db.bureau.local

    $ORIGIN bureau.local.
    $TTL 604800
    @ IN SOA wordpress.bureau.local. blots.free.fr. (
    4 ; Serial
    604800 ; Refresh
    86400 ; Retry
    2419200 ; Expire
    604800 ) ; Negative Cache TTL
    ;
    @ IN NS wordpress.bureau.local.
    ;
    @ IN MX 10 mail.bureau.local.
    ;
    dns IN A 192.168.1.142
    wordpress IN A 192.168.1.142
    index IN A 192.168.1.142
    mail IN A 192.168.1.142

    contenu de /etc/bind/db.1.168.192

    $ORIGIN 1.168.192.in-addr.arpa.
    $TTL 604800

    @ IN SOA wordpress.bureau.local. blots.free.fr. (
    3 ; Serial
    604800 ; Refresh
    86400 ; Retry
    2419200 ; Expire
    604800 ) ; Negative Cache TTL
    ;
    @ IN NS wordpress.bureau.local.
    ;
    @ IN MX 10 mail.bureau.local.
    ;
    142 IN PTR dns.bureau.local.
    142 IN PTR wordpress.bureau.local.
    142 IN PTR index.bureau.local.
    142 IN PTR mail.bureau.local.


    contenu de /etc/bind/named.conf.options

    ptions {
    directory "/var/cache/bind";

    // If there is a firewall between you and nameservers you want
    // to talk to, you may need to fix the firewall to allow multiple
    // ports to talk. See http://www.kb.cert.org/vuls/id/800113

    // If your ISP provided one or more IP addresses for stable
    // nameservers, you probably want to use them as forwarders.
    // Uncomment the following block, and insert the addresses replacing
    // the all-0's placeholder.

    // forwarders {
    // 0.0.0.0;
    // };

    auth-nxdomain no; # conform to RFC1035
    listen-on-v6 { any; };
    };

    tous mes services sont bien redémarrer avec :

    /etc/init.d/bind restart


    je devrai arriver sur ma page par défaut de apache non ?
    j'ai dû oublier de faire quelques chose mais je ne sais pas quoi .


    si vous pouviez m’éclairer car malgré la lecture de plusieurs tutoriel qui se ressemble tous, je n’arrive toujours pas à faire fonctionner ce bind.

  2. #2
    Invité
    Invité(e)
    Par défaut
    Salut,

    Où se trouve le navigateur depuis lequel tu fais tes tests? Sur le serveur même sur un autre poste? S'il s'agit d'un autre poste, as-tu également ajouté le serveur dns dans la configuration?

    Que renvoie la commande depuis le serveur dns?

    dig wordpress.bureau.local

    Quel nom de domaine as-tu testé?
    As-tu défini de virtual host pour le(s) hostname(s) que tu souhaites testé au niveau de ton serveur apache? quelle est la configuration de ce virtualhost?

  3. #3
    Expert confirmé
    Avatar de becket
    Profil pro
    Informaticien multitâches
    Inscrit en
    Février 2005
    Messages
    2 854
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ations professionnelles :
    Activité : Informaticien multitâches
    Secteur : Service public

    Informations forums :
    Inscription : Février 2005
    Messages : 2 854
    Par défaut
    Que renvoie :

    Le pc sur lequel tu fais le test est bien configuré pour utiliser ton serveur dns fraichement crée ?

  4. #4
    Membre du Club
    Homme Profil pro
    Inscrit en
    Janvier 2013
    Messages
    10
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ations forums :
    Inscription : Janvier 2013
    Messages : 10
    Par défaut
    bonsoir
    je suis content d'avoir des reponses ce soir

    tout d'abord je fais mes test depuis mon pc perso sous windows 7( 192.168.1.10 )

    en réponse à la commande dig wordpress.bureau.local :

    ; <<>> DiG 9.7.3 <<>> wordpress.bureau.local
    ;; global options: +cmd
    ;; Got answer:
    ;; ->>HEADER<<- opcode: QUERY, status: NOERROR, id: 32689
    ;; flags: qr aa rd ra; QUERY: 1, ANSWER: 1, AUTHORITY: 1, ADDITIONAL: 0

    ;; QUESTION SECTION:
    ;wordpress.bureau.local. IN A

    ;; ANSWER SECTION:
    wordpress.bureau.local. 604800 IN A 192.168.1.142

    ;; AUTHORITY SECTION:
    bureau.local. 604800 IN NS wordpress.bureau.local.

    ;; Query time: 0 msec
    ;; SERVER: 192.168.1.142#53(192.168.1.142)
    ;; WHEN: Wed Jan 9 20:20:06 2013
    ;; MSG SIZE rcvd: 70


    pour les virtual host sur le serveur j'ai bien fais ma configuration dans /etc/apache2/sites-available
    j'y ai créer un fichier wordpress.bureau.local et voici son contenu :

    <VirtualHost *:80>
    # Adresse email à contacter en cas de problemes
    ServerAdmin blots@free.fr
    # Nom de domaine avec les www
    ServerName www.wordpress.bureau.local
    # Les différents alias du site, généralement le NDD sans les www
    ServerAlias wordpress.bureau.local
    # La où sont stocké les données du site
    DocumentRoot /home/wordpress/www
    <Directory />
    # Des options : ici suivre les liens symboliques
    Options FollowSymLinks
    # Autoriser l'override, autrement dit les .htaccess
    AllowOverride All
    </Directory>
    <Directory /home/wordpress/www>
    # Encore des options : multiviews peut être pratique
    # Si on essaye d'accéder à site.com/index
    # Et que index n'existe pas, le serveur va rechercher index.*
    # Autrement dit : index.php, index.html etc...
    Options FollowSymLinks MultiViews
    # Autorise les htaccess
    AllowOverride All
    Order allow,deny
    allow from all
    </Directory>
    # Log pour les erreurs
    ErrorLog ${APACHE_LOG_DIR}/error.log
    LogLevel warn
    # Log des connexion au site
    CustomLog ${APACHE_LOG_DIR}/access.log combined
    </VirtualHost>

    pour la commande netstat -atpn :

    Connexions Internet actives (serveurs et établies)
    Proto Recv-Q Send-Q Adresse locale Adresse distante Etat PID/Program name
    tcp 0 0 0.0.0.0:40555 0.0.0.0:* LISTEN 865/rpc.statd
    tcp 0 0 0.0.0.0:111 0.0.0.0:* LISTEN 852/portmap
    tcp 0 0 0.0.0.0:10000 0.0.0.0:* LISTEN 1418/perl
    tcp 0 0 0.0.0.0:4949 0.0.0.0:* LISTEN 1653/munin-node
    tcp 0 0 0.0.0.0:21 0.0.0.0:* LISTEN 1582/proftpd: (acce
    tcp 0 0 192.168.1.142:53 0.0.0.0:* LISTEN 1115/named
    tcp 0 0 127.0.0.1:53 0.0.0.0:* LISTEN 1115/named
    tcp 0 0 0.0.0.0:4598 0.0.0.0:* LISTEN 1030/monit
    tcp 0 0 0.0.0.0:22 0.0.0.0:* LISTEN 1165/sshd
    tcp 0 0 0.0.0.0:25 0.0.0.0:* LISTEN 1567/master
    tcp 0 0 127.0.0.1:953 0.0.0.0:* LISTEN 1115/named
    tcp 0 0 127.0.0.1:3306 0.0.0.0:* LISTEN 1309/mysqld
    tcp 0 52 192.168.1.142:22 192.168.1.10:53416 ESTABLISHED 9819/0
    tcp6 0 0 :::139 :::* LISTEN 1062/smbd
    tcp6 0 0 :::110 :::* LISTEN 1125/couriertcpd
    tcp6 0 0 :::143 :::* LISTEN 1154/couriertcpd
    tcp6 0 0 :::80 :::* LISTEN 5363/apache2
    tcp6 0 0 :::53 :::* LISTEN 1115/named
    tcp6 0 0 :::22 :::* LISTEN 1165/sshd
    tcp6 0 0 ::1:953 :::* LISTEN 1115/named
    tcp6 0 0 :::445 :::* LISTEN 1062/smbd

    je n'ai pas fais plus sur mon pc de bureau . je ne vois pas pourquoi je devrai configurer le pc sur laquel je tente d'accéder à ce serveur . Le but étant de ne pas toucher au fichier hosts de mon pc .

  5. #5
    Invité
    Invité(e)
    Par défaut
    Salut,

    En niveau de ton pc windows, tu dois ajouter l'adresse ip de ton serveur dns pour que les noms d'hôtes *.bureau.local puissent être résolus. Est-ce le cas?

    Au niveau de l'apache,

    Il n'y a aucun hostname www.wordpress.bureau.local qui est spécifié dans ta config dns. Tu dois donc mettre wordpress.bureau.local dans la directive ServerName. et au niveau du navigateur tu dois taper l'url http://wordpress.bureau.local

  6. #6
    Membre du Club
    Homme Profil pro
    Inscrit en
    Janvier 2013
    Messages
    10
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ations forums :
    Inscription : Janvier 2013
    Messages : 10
    Par défaut
    je suis embéter car je ne comprend pas ce que tu me demandes de faire.

Discussions similaires

  1. [apache] configuration d'apache
    Par hbendali dans le forum Apache
    Réponses: 5
    Dernier message: 21/12/2005, 22h28
  2. Configuration bind
    Par gIch dans le forum Apache
    Réponses: 5
    Dernier message: 06/12/2005, 17h32
  3. Réponses: 2
    Dernier message: 03/11/2005, 08h45
  4. Problème de configuration MySQL Apache
    Par FredMines dans le forum Installation
    Réponses: 4
    Dernier message: 01/07/2005, 11h43

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o